Gastrin releasing peptide (GRP), a 27 amino acid neuropeptide is a
mammalian homologue of the amphibian tetradecapeptide bombesin (1). The
carboxy terminal fourteen amino acid residues of mammalian GRP are very
similar to amphibian bombesin, particularly the terminal heptapeptide which
appears to be the biologically active region of the molecule that is
critical for binding to receptors (2). Bombesin/GRP has been detected in
mammalian brain (3) and also in peripheral nerve cells of the gut (4) where
it is known to stimulate the release of gastrin from G cells in the gastric
mucosa in dogs and humans. In addition, bombesin/GRP has been detected in
the pulmonary endocrine cells of normal bronchial epithelium (5), as well
as in lung carcinoid tumors (6,7) and human small cell lung cancer (SCLC)
(8,9,10).
Under certain circumstances, GRP can stimulate the growth of human SCLC
cell lines (11,12), normal human bronchial epithelial cells (13), and mouse
Swiss 3T3 cells (14) where its growth promoting properties appear to be
mediated by a cell surface receptor (15). GRP is both synthesized and
secreted by some SCLC cell lines and can also stimulate cell growth,
indicating this neuropeptide may function as an autocrine growth factor
that contributes to the transformed growth properties of SCLC (12).
Our group focused its attention on extending these studies by exploring the
molecular biology of the pre-pro GRP gene. As a first step in this
analysis, we obtained a collection of about 25 GRP cDNA clones from several
human SCLC cDNA libraries generated in this laboratory. Analysis of these
clones revealed a pre-pro GRP translation product consisting of a signal
sequence, the predicted 27 amino acid GRP neuropeptide, and a novel
GRP-associated peptide representing the carboxy portion of the
translational reading frame encoding GRP (16,17).
